Abstract
Energy is a big issue in our society, fueled by growing awareness of the finite resources of liquid fossil fuels and the noticeable changes in our climate resulting from its consumption. The general consensus is that there should be a well-considered roadmap towards a future energy scenario, with the replacement of fossil energy by renewable energies as the final goal. This “Chemistry of Energy Conversion and Storage” issue contains papers dealing with the chemistry behind renewable energies.
